WebMost adhesive tapes used with home projects are pressure sensitive, as opposed to tapes with adhesion activated by heat or water. The most common types of tape include … WebMost adhesive tapes used with home projects are pressure sensitive, as opposed to tapes with adhesion activated by heat or water. The most common types of tape include masking tape, flooring tape, duct tape, electrical tape, packing tape, painter’s tape and double sided or mounting tape .
